Unlocking Creativity with Tinker DIY: A Comprehensive App Review
Imagine having a virtual workshop at your fingertips—Tinker DIY is precisely that, turning your ideas into tangible projects with ease and fun. Developed by the innovative team at TechInnovate Labs, this application aims to fuel your maker spirit, whether you're a seasoned DIY enthusiast or a curious beginner.
App Overview: Your Digital Canvas for DIY Innovation
Positioned as a creative toolkit, Tinker DIY offers users a versatile platform to design, simulate, and prototype a wide array of DIY projects. The app's primary strength lies in its user-centric design and rich feature set, crafted to streamline the traditionally complex process of DIY creation. Key highlights include an intuitive drag-and-drop interface, real-time simulation capabilities, and a vast library of components and tutorials. The target audience spans hobbyists, educators, students, and professionals eager to bring their ideas to life digitally before building physically.
Making Ideas Come Alive: Core Features Explored
Simplified Design & Customization
One of Tinker DIY's standout features is its user-friendly design environment. Think of it as a well-organized workshop bench—organized, accessible, and accommodating. The drag-and-drop interface allows users to assemble components effortlessly, reducing the learning curve most technical apps impose. Whether creating a simple electronic circuit or a complex mechanical prototype, users can customize parts with adjustable parameters, ensuring every detail aligns with their vision. This feature is especially invaluable for beginners who might be daunted by traditional CAD tools yet crave the satisfaction of building virtually.
Real-Time Simulation & Testing
The app's simulation engine is akin to having a virtual test lab in your pocket. Once your design is assembled, you can run real-time experiments—observing electronic flows, mechanical movements, or sensor responses—all without physically assembling a single part. This capability significantly accelerates the prototyping phase and helps identify issues early, saving both time and materials. The intuitive visualization makes it easy to interpret results, making iterations a breeze and fostering a deeper understanding of underlying principles.
Extensive Library & Guided Projects
For those seeking inspiration and guidance, Tinker DIY boasts a comprehensive library of predefined modules, tutorials, and example projects. It's like having a seasoned mentor sitting beside you, guiding your every step. This feature not only lowers the barrier to entry but also promotes continuous learning. Users can modify existing projects or start from scratch, making it adaptable for various skill levels and project types—from robotics to home automation.

Pros
User-friendly interface
Tinker DIY features an intuitive layout that makes it easy for beginners to navigate and start their projects quickly.
Extensive library of tutorials
The app provides a wide range of step-by-step guides suitable for various skill levels, enhancing learning experiences.
Robot customization options
Users can easily modify and program their robots within the app, fostering creativity and technical skills.
Community support features
Built-in forums and sharing features enable users to exchange ideas, troubleshoot, and inspire each other.
Compatibility with multiple devices
Tinker DIY works smoothly across smartphones and tablets, providing flexible access to users.
Cons
Limited hardware integration (impact: medium)
Currently, the app supports only specific robot kits, which may limit options for users with different hardware setups.
Occasional app crashes (impact: low)
Some users have reported crashes during complex programming tasks; updating to the latest version or reinstalling may temporarily resolve this.
Offline functionality restrictions (impact: medium)
Certain features require an active internet connection, which can hinder offline learning; future updates may enhance offline capabilities.
Limited advanced programming tutorials (impact: low)
While beginner guides are comprehensive, advanced users might find the content lacks depth; official roadmap indicates upcoming advanced modules.
Design customization options are basic (impact: low)
Current customization features may not satisfy users seeking highly personalized robot designs; using external tools can partially address this temporarily.
Frequently Asked Questions
How do I get started with Tinker DIY as a beginner?
Download the app, register an account, then browse the beginner projects in the categories section to start your DIY journey easily.
Can I access tutorials and instructions offline?
Yes, download project tutorials within the app by tapping the download button on each project to access them offline anytime.
How do I find projects suitable for my skill level?
Navigate to the categories tab and select projects based on difficulty levels, from beginner to advanced, to find suitable crafts.
How do I update my material list for a specific project?
Open the project details page; the comprehensive materials list is included there for your reference and preparation.
How can I connect with other DIY enthusiasts in the app?
Go to the community section from the main menu to share your work, exchange tips, and view other users' projects.
What are the main features of Tinker DIY's project tutorials?
Each project includes detailed step-by-step instructions and engaging video tutorials, covering various skill levels for easy following.
Are there premium features or content available through subscription?
Yes, you can subscribe via Settings > Account > Subscription to access exclusive projects, additional tutorials, and community perks.
How do I subscribe or cancel my Tinker DIY subscription?
Go to Settings > Account > Subscription to manage your subscription options, including subscribing or canceling as needed.
What should I do if the app crashes or has technical issues?
Try restarting your device or reinstall the app. If problems persist, contact support through Settings > Help & Feedback.
